
Morgan Stanley reported that the annualized premium equivalent (APE) for private insurers in India grew by 28%, up from a previous base of 12%. In a separate earnings call, HDFC Life Insurance revised its growth outlook to 18-20% from an earlier forecast of 15%. However, the company is facing challenges as shrinking margins have negatively impacted its shares, despite a rise in profits. This information reflects the current state of the life insurance sector in India, highlighting both growth opportunities and financial pressures on major players like HDFC Life.
